February 3, 1959 has become one of the most mythic days in rock ‘n’ roll history. It’s the day the 1947 Beechcraft Bonanza 35 carrying Buddy Holly, Ritchie Valens and J.P. “The Big Bopper” Richardson crashed in an Iowa cornfield. To many, it’s simply the day the music died.
